Fun facts about CULP INC

Quirks, history, and lore behind CULP — the kind of stuff that makes a stock memorable.

  • 1
    The Basics
    A small-cap U.S. manufacturer in the Consumer Discretionary sector, listed on the NYSE and headquartered in North Carolina.
  • 2
    The Numbers
    Annual revenue in the range of a few hundred million dollars, with two distinct business segments that together cover nearly every upholstered surface in your living room.
  • 3
    The History
    Founded in the mid-20th century in the heart of America's furniture manufacturing belt, the Piedmont region of North Carolina, where the industry once clustered.
  • 4
    The Secret
    The company doesn't make finished furniture — it makes the fabrics and foam that go inside and on top of it, supplying the furniture makers themselves.
  • 5
    The Lore
    Its two segments are upholstery fabrics and mattress fabrics — meaning it quietly wraps both the sofa you sit on and the bed you sleep in every night.
